STATEMENT:
My work is about my lifelong passion for and connection to nature. To convey the sense of mystery I find hidden there, I use its colors, shapes, textures and shadows as elements in my paintings.
Although seemingly chaotic, nature has its own structure. My response to nature's movement and energy as well as its structure is what connects and grounds me.
In the process of creating these artworks I recapture my original response to all that my world has to offer visually as well as emotionally. It is this wonder and beauty I want the viewer to see.
BIOGRAPHY:
I was born and raised in Pontiac, Michigan. I attended the University of Michigan, graduating with a Bachelor of Science Degree in Design. I moved to the west coast that year to attend the University of Washington in Seattle, completing my Master of Fine Arts Degree. My thesis work was figure painting, with an emphasis in oils.
Since completing my graduate studies, I have exhibited my work extensively in Michigan, Washington, British Columbia and California. I won Fourth Place in the Mixed Media category at the California Works exhibition in Sacramento. My paintings, drawings, prints, sculpture and handmade paper pieces are in private collections and public buildings throughout the west and mid-west.
